A leading content and localization firm in the United Kingdom is seeking an experienced Technical Lead to join their team. This role involves creating and revising Maintenance Instructions for hydroelectric power stations, ensuring quality delivery aligned with customer specifications.

The successful candidate will manage and guide a team of technical authors while also collaborating closely with engineering teams. Candidates should have a strong mechanical engineering background and experience in technical publications, particularly with Maintenance Instructions. Hybridity in work arrangement is offered.
